MANILA, Philippines–Davao City Mayor Rodrigo Duterte warned rogue police officers who engage in “hulidap” to never set foot in his city or else they will be dead.

“Huwag kang maghulidap-hulidap dito. Papatayin kita. Pulis na maghulidap dito, I’ll shoot you,” Duterte said in an interview with Davao City reporters Wednesday night.

[Do not attempt “hulidap” here. I will kill you. Policemen who will attempt to commit “hulidap” here, I’ll shoot you.]

“Hulidap” refers to arresting civilians on trumped-up charges and releasing them in exchange for money.

Duterte cautioned erring cops to avoid being assigned to Davao because he will kill them.

“Do not do it in my city. Ilan ba ang siyudad ng Pilipinas? Seventy-two? Mamili ka ng siyudad na assignment na huwag dito sa Davao kasi papatayin talaga kita,” Duterte added.

[Do not do it in my city. How many cities are there in the Philippines? Seventy-two? You pick an assignment but not in Davao because I will kill you.]

The statement was a reaction to the P2 million robbery-abduction incident on Epifanio de los Santos Avenue (EDSA) in Mandaluyong City last week which involved 10 policemen.

Duterte also called for the Philippine National Police’s heightened vigilance, saying that crimes in the country have spiked.
